Andrew,
You don't have to sign up for the weekend. You can sign up only for a Saturday or only for a Sunday if you wish.
As for what time to show up at, well that depends on how much you like to rush and how much time you need to prep.
In the morning you have to register (which closes at 8:30 sharp) and you need to get your car registered, put on the decals, change wheels/tires, adjust tire pressure, etc. I would say that you would need to be there no later than 8:00.

Magnetic Vinyl.
Mad Macs, one of our sponsors, sells sheets of magnetic vinyl. Perry: Will you have some for sale at the Open House?
Come to the Open House, pick up your decals, get a sheet from our sponsor, or any graphics suppy place. Stick on the decals, use a metal ruler and utility knife to cut up the sheet, and they easily go on and off your car.
Store them on the beer fridge in the garage to keep them nice and flat between events.
